Educational Objectives

Educational Aim:
The aim of this article is to give the reader a comprehensive overview of the different roles of play interventions in a hospital setting over the last 20 years.

Educational Outcomes:
Upon completion of this module practitioners should have a clear understanding of:

  1. The importance of play in a hospital setting.
  2. The four different roles that play intervention serves in a clinical context.
  3. The necessity of play intervention to reduce pain, stress and anxiety in a paediatric hospital setting.
